SEK-Dublin International School, part of the SEK Education Group, is seeking to immediately appoint an Administrative Accounting Technician.

Mission

The Administrative Accounting Technician plays a key role in ensuring the financial accuracy, operational efficiency, and regulatory compliance of the school. This position supports the school’s strategic objectives by managing financial processes, administrative operations, and coordination with internal and external stakeholders.


Key Responsibilities

  • Manage daily accounting operations, payments, and collections
  • Handle invoicing processes and tax filings in compliance with local regulations
  • Prepare and monitor budgets and support payroll processes
  • Coordinate with external advisors regarding contracts, legal matters, and compliance
  • Oversee employee and student insurance administration
  • Manage procurement processes and supplier relationships
  • Coordinate school transport logistics
  • Organize student and faculty trips, including flights, accommodation, and itineraries
  • Ensure proper documentation and reporting in accordance with internal policies

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Economics, Law, or a related field
  • Fluent in English and Spanish (C1 level or higher in both languages)
  • Minimum of 3 years’ experience in a similar administrative/accounting role
  • Strong proficiency in Excel, Microsoft Office Suite, and xcfaprz IT systems
  • Experience with Navision and Alexia (preferred)
  • High level of organization, accuracy, and confidentiality
  • Strong communication and coordination skills
